Joy Always Comes in the Morning

SOLO EXHIBITION

14th - 31st October 2022

Joy Always Comes in the Morning is an exhibition culminating multiple series of works made by Gayle Ebose in the last three years. The title is derived from a verse in the Christian scriptures Psalm 30, where the writer reflects on the moving experiences of life, where ‘weeping may occur in the night, but joy comes with the morning’. It is an encapsulation of Ebose’s continuous thought processes towards life’s joys and sorrows wrapped simultaneously in the human experience and reflects the journey of her practice so far as she works on her visual language of expressing hope, contemplation, faith and anchoring in the faces of her subjects.

Joy Always Comes in the Morning is an exhibition that is both reflective and celebratory, drawing from many conversations she had over video calls with friends during the pandemic and yet opens new ways of making as we move forward as a society within our communities.

Through this global experience, Gayle Ebose’s work became almost a healing space for her and her subjects as they exchanged words of encouragement over video calls and reminded one another of the hope they had through such trying times. The works are akin to documents and biographies of a collective moment in time. The pandemic was a blessing in disguise to her process of making and continues to inform her practice today.
